Decoding BBG: The Basics
Alright, guys,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. BBG is a structured workout program focused on high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and resistance training. Itsines created these guides with a simple, yet effective, philosophy: to help people of all fitness levels build strength, burn fat, and tone their bodies in a manageable and sustainable way. Think of BBG as your personal trainer in a book (or app!). The program is broken down into weeks, each progressively challenging, with exercises targeting different muscle groups.
The core of the BBG program typically involves three main elements: resistance training, cardio, and recovery. Resistance training is the heart of BBG, utilizing bodyweight exercises and optional equipment like dumbbells or resistance bands to build muscle and increase metabolism. Cardio sessions can include a mix of low-intensity steady-state (LISS) workouts, such as brisk walking or jogging,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T) to torch calories and improve cardiovascular health. And of course, recovery is crucial – think stretching and rest days to allow your body to repair and rebuild.

The Benefits of BBG Workouts: Why Everyone's Talking About It
Okay, so we know what BBG is, but why is it so popular? What makes it a go-to choice for so many people seeking a transformation? Let's break down the amazing benefits of BBG that have people raving!
First off, BBG workouts are incredibly efficient. Time is precious, and BBG understands that. These workouts are designed to maximize results in minimal time. You're looking at about 30 minutes, 3-4 times a week. This is a huge win for those with busy schedules! Moreover, BBG is designed for all fitness levels. Whether you're a beginner or a seasoned gym-goer, the program offers modifications and progressions. You can start where you are and gradually increase the intensity as your fitness improves. This inclusivity makes it a sustainable choice for long-term fitness.
Another key benefit is the emphasis on building a strong, healthy body. BBG isn't just about weight loss; it's about building lean muscle, improving your overall strength, and boosting your metabolism. This results in a toned physique and increased energy levels. Plus, the combination of resistance training and cardio provides a well-rounded approach to fitness. You're not just burning calories; you're also building a strong foundation and improving your cardiovascular health.

BBG: Frequently Asked Questions
Let's tackle some of the most common questions about BBG.
- Is BBG suitable for beginners? Absolutely! BBG offers modifications and progressions for all fitness levels. You can easily adapt the exercises to match your current abilities and gradually increase the intensity as you get stronger.
- Do I need any equipment? While some exercises can be done with bodyweight alone, investing in basic equipment like dumbbells and resistance bands can enhance your workouts. It depends on the specific BBG program you choose.
- How long are the workouts? BBG workouts typically last around 30 minutes, making them a great option for people with busy schedules.
- How often should I work out? The program typically recommends 3-4 BBG workouts per week, along with cardio sessions and rest days.
- What should I eat while doing BBG? BBG recommends a balanced diet with plenty of protein, fruits, vegetables, and whole grains to fuel your workouts and support recovery.
